Check out this short video demonstrating running uphill. A summary of what is covered:

  • Engage your core muscles in abdomen & hips
  • Lean forward and aim to strike the ground with a flat foot or mid-foot
  • Use arms to drive knee upward & forward but keep them close to your upper body
  • Take short fast steps (high cadence)
  • Avoid striking the ground with your heels & taking long strides
  • Avoid bending over at the hips – look forward to assess the terrain ahead
  • When doing a trail event consider the traction on the bottom of your shoe and either upgrade to a new shoe or consider a trail specific shoe depending on the conditions and the event
